или вообще возможно это реализовать?
Вам нужно посмотреть в сторону AdapterDelegates.
В setItems - баги. Невозможно передать/показать пустой список. Непонятно, зачем параметр допускает null. setItems на самом деле addItems. Она только добавляет больше и больше.
Нужно обеспечить создание разных view holder в зависимости от viewType. Через наследование можно сделать.
задача требовало чтобы null тоже обрабативалось
да но я начинающий и мне не до конца понятно как эта реализовать
Зачем вообще передавать null, если он не несёт никакой полезной информации?
Обсуждают сегодня